§ 43-01-23 — Temporary authority of an abstracter to act in an additional county

1.If it appears to the board that there is no abstracter authorized to engage in and carry
on the business of an abstracter of real estate titles in a county or that there is an
authorized abstracter in a county who is unable to perform the duties of an abstracter
due to death, disability, a disaster or emergency, or disciplinary action, the board may
authorize an individual or organization having a certificate of authority and certificate of
registration to operate in another county to operate in the county having no abstracter
through the issuance of a temporary certificate of authority. The board may not charge
an abstracter for the temporary certificate of authority. The board may require
additional security than provided under section 43-01-11. The abstracter operating
